In Bergkirchen (Bavaria, Dachau district immediately west of Munich), TeamSport E-Karting Kart Palast Funpark München operates what the European TeamSport chain claims as the world's largest indoor e-karting center after the takeover of Kart Palast Funpark in winter 2022. The multi-track configuration on several superimposed levels is exceptional: four tracks distributed over four distinct levels with a total drop of 12 meters between floors, cumulative length 1.6 kilometers (Raceway 1 levels 3-4 = 550 m, Raceway 2 levels 2-3 = 470 m, Raceway 3 levels 1-2 = 500 m).

On-site amenities: indoor adventure mini-golf, 6 Brunswick bowling lanes, arcade room, billiards, other games, on-site restaurant with wood-fired pizza and local specialties. Target audience: e-karting accessible from age 8, Nano Karts from age 3 (very wide age range for families). Extended hours: Monday-Thursday 9:30 am-11:30 pm, Friday-Saturday and holidays 9:30 am-1 am, Sunday 8:30 am-11 pm. Address Gadastraße 9 in the Bergkirchen GADA Industriegebiet, direct access via A8 Munich-Augsburg motorway Olching exit. Contact +49 8131 3863015.
